What to check before for buildings near the L train in East Williamsburg

  • Confirm commute fit in real time: check the exact station walk time and whether it matches your hours and transfers.
  • Use the building page to verify availability details, lease start flexibility, and any listed move-in requirements.
  • Review the apartment’s full cost, not just the asking rent: ask about deposits, broker/fee expectations, and utility responsibilities.
  • If you have pets, confirm building-specific rules directly (fees, limits, and any documentation)—filters don’t replace landlord confirmation.
  • Before touring, note any recurring maintenance or noise concerns from rated-building info and tenant Q&A, then ask the building manager what’s changed recently.
